This morning we continued our drive up the Mississippi River on the Great River Road. We stopped in Red Wing, Minnesota for a latte. It is the home of Red Wing Shoes which are still being made here. We crossed over to the Wisconsin side once more and stopped in the town of Prescott where the Saint Croix River flows into the Mississippi. You can see the distinction between the two rivers for some distance downstream of their confluence because the clear water of the Saint Croix doesn't immediately mix with the muddy Mississippi. ( I admit that this is a little difficult to discern in the photo, but trust me, it's true.) After that we drove into the Twin Cities, or more precisely, we drove to Bloomington.
